Milliliter in 2.6 liters

There are 2600 ml in 2.6 liters.

How lites liters in 1 milliliter?

There are 0.001 liters in 1 milliliter. This is because 1 liter is equal to 1,000 milliliters, so to convert milliliters to liters, you divide by 1,000. Thus, 1 milliliter is one-thousandth of a liter.
